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
71108880 85018669 9912918316
61709216730 445732
61709216730 445732
857757 6834334173 08063
All about undefined
Interested in learning more?
61709216730 445732
857757 6834334173 08063
See more
86867166918 173632
376076 44454 3076 066852
See more
9499182888 66161 6077580
8630 7350914869 86399790
See more